The Building for Life Standard, a new housing design quality standard backed by government and the housing industry, has been launched. The standard will help buyers identify the highest quality new housing projects and rewards house builders who strive to achieve design excellence. Schemes are assessed against criteria such as good place making, parking and pedestrianisation, design and construction and their environmental impact.
